Polygala major
Polygala major
Koca sütotu
Perennial with a woody caudex. Stems numerous, ascending, up to 60 cm. Leaves alternate, close, the lower spathulate to lanceolate, the upper lanceolate to linear-lanceolate, larger than the lower. Inflorescences all terminal, ± glabrous, bracts exceeding the pedicels. Upper sepal not gibbous. Inner sepals obovate to elliptic to broadly elliptic, 10-15 x 4-5 mm, shorter than the corolla tube, pink to red purple. Capsule oblong, abruptly narrowed into a stipe which is as long as or longer than the capsule, narrowly winged, the wing ± equally broad all round the capsule. Fl. 5-9. Rocky slopes, banks and ledges, s.l.-2250 m.
S. & C. Europe, S. Russia, Caucasia, N. Iran. Euro-Sib. element.
